This 1967 Cessna 182K Skylane, registration N2583R, presents with a total airframe time of 4,278 hours and is equipped for VFR flight. The aircraft is powered by a Continental O-470-R engine with 979 hours since its major overhaul by Aircraft Specialties, and it has just 4 hours since a fresh top-end cylinder overhaul was completed by Gibson Aviation at the annual inspection in August 2025. The propeller is a two-blade McCauley unit with 382 hours since new.
